Over 13,500 illegal migrants deported from Moscow in 2013

All Moscow’s law-enforcement authorities were involved in identifying the offenders

MOSCOW, October 14 (Itar-Tass) - More than 13.5 thousand illegal irregular migrants residing in the territory of Moscow have been deported from Russia since the beginning of this year, Olga Kirillova, the head of the Moscow branch of the Federal Migration Service, told journalists on Monday.

“Over 13,500 foreign nationals have had to be deported for different offences. All Moscow’s law-enforcement authorities were involved in identifying the offenders,” Kirillova said.
